I just want to throw in my data points on intel G45 (Asus P5Q-EM)
hardware, dual monitors 1920x1200 & 1024x768

1. Intrepid with home-built mesa including the 4096 patch:  stable for
several months, EXA acceleration, compiz ok.  glxgears 500-600.

2. Stock Jaunty + EXA.  I've tried a couple of configurations with EXA
and every time I get a "can't pin front buffer" error.

3. Stock Jaunty + UXA + NoDRI.  Stable, but no compiz.

4.  Stock Jaunty + UXA + Ludovico Cavedon's ppa 
https://edge.launchpad.net/~cavedon/+archive/ppa
Frequent and unpredictable lock-ups on X, otherwise great performance.

5. xorg-edgers ppa enabled + rebuilt DRI with MAX_TEXTURES=4096 patch.
Similar performance to #4.  Awesome glxgears 1200+ but unpredictable lockups on 
X.
